The situation in the UK is equally confusing.

Breakfast = desayuno/ No problem

Late breakfast or early lunch = brunch (US mainly)

Tea/ coffee and biscuits at 11 o´clock = elevenses

Midday meal = lunch (usually a light meal) or dinner (main meal)

Afternoon tea / high tea = sandwiches & tea /coffee

Evening meal = dinner or tea

A little later = dinner or supper

At bedtime = supper

Society is changing rapidly and eating arrangements depend on work patterns and location. Dinner is the main meal of the day but people tend to graze at all times of the day on fast foods.
Our children can have "School dinners" at lunchtime or dinnertime. 12.00/1.00pm
They come home for their tea at teatime 5.00/6.00pm´ .... all very confusing!!
